@charset "utf-8";
/* CSS Document */
.bgwt {background:url("../image/bunner/help_3.jpg") no-repeat center;}
.bgcn {background:url("../image/bunner/help_1.jpg") no-repeat center;}
.bgxz {background:url("../image/bunner/help_2.jpg") no-repeat center;}
.bgps {background:url("../image/bunner/help_4.jpg") no-repeat center;}
.bglc {background:url("../image/bunner/help_5.jpg") no-repeat center;}
.bggy {background:url("../image/bunner/help_6.jpg") no-repeat center;}
.mainbox {width: 100%; height: auto; border-bottom: 1px solid #eaeaea;}
.mainbox .header {width: 100%; height: 480px; background-color: #000000;}
.mainbox .header .title {width: 1140px; height: 480px; margin: 0px auto;}
.mainbox .header .title .logo {width: 73px; height: 57px; position: relative; top: 40px; left: 2px; float: left;}
.mainbox .header .title .logotitle {width: 300px; height: 71px; font-size: 57px; font-weight: 500; line-height: 71px; color: #fff; position: relative; top: 30px; left: 5px; float: left;}
.mainbox .header .title .exname {width: 300px; height: 24px; font-size: 16px; font-weight: 200; line-height: 24px; color: #fff; top: 30px; left: 2px; position: relative;}
.mainbox .header .title .maintitle {width: 300px; height: 50px; font-size: 48px; margin: 10px auto; text-align: left; color: #fff; top: 170px; position: relative; left: 55px; font-weight: 800; text-shadow: 0px 0px 4px #fff;}
.main {width: 1140px; height: auto; margin: 0px auto; position: relative;}

.mainbox .goodsNavi {width: 1140px; height: 40px; position: relative; margin: 0px auto;}
.mainbox .goodsNavi .ftas {color: #fc2828 !important;}
.mainbox .goodsNavi ul li {list-style: none; float: left; margin-left: 25px; font-size: 24px; color: #000; line-height: 40px;}
.mainbox .goodsNavi ul li div {width: 40px; height: 40px; color: #000; font-size: 18px; text-align: center; line-height: 40px; box-shadow: 0 0px 5px rgba(0, 0, 0, 0.5); -webkit-transition: all 0.6s cubic-bezier(0.165, 0.84, 0.44, 1); transition: all 0.6s cubic-bezier(0.165, 0.84, 0.44, 1); border-radius: 3px; }
.mainbox .goodsNavi ul li div:hover {box-shadow: 0 0px 5px rgba(0, 0, 0, 1); -webkit-transform: translateY(-5px); transform: translateY(-5px);}
#mainbox2 td {border: 1px solid #bebebe; font-size: 16px; line-height: 20px;}

.goodstitle {
	width: 100%; height: 46px; background: #dd1528; color: #fff; font-size: 22px; line-height: 46px;
}

.goodstitle .titlename {
	width: 1140px; height: 46px;  background: #dd1528; margin: 0px auto; font-weight: 400; text-align: left;
}

.goodstitle .titlename span {margin-left: 5px;}
.topNavh {width: 100%; height: 22px; border-bottom: 1px solid #A0A0A0; font-size: 14px;}
.topNavh .tpnvh {width: 1140px; height: 22px; margin: 0px auto; border-bottom: 1px solid #A0A0A0;}
.topNavh .tpnvh .pich {width: 18px; height: 18px; margin: 2px 2px; float: right; color: #fc2828;}
.topNavh .tpnvh .adsh {width: 62px; height: 22px; float: right; line-height: 22px; color: #fff;}
.topNavh .tpnvh .telh {width: 90px; height: 22px; float: right; line-height: 22px; text-align: right; color: #FFF; margin-right: 2px;}

.goodsarea {width: 100%; height: auto; margin: 0px;}
.goodsdt {width:1140px; margin:1px auto;}
.goodsdt .list {width: 200px; position: relative; float: left;}
.goodsdt .list .tta {height: 40px; color: #fc2828; text-align: left; padding-left: 25px; font-size: 22px; font-weight: 700; line-height: 40px; border-bottom: 1px dotted #c3c3c3;}
.goodsdt .list .ttc {height: 40px; color: #4d4d4d; text-align: left; padding-left: 5px; font-size: 18px; font-weight: 300; line-height: 40px; border-bottom: 1px dotted #c3c3c3;}
.goodsdt .list .ttc a, a:active, a:visited {color: #000;}
.goodsdt .list .ttc a:hover {color: #fc2828;}
.goodsdt .list .ttd {height: 40px; color: #4d4d4d; text-align: left; padding-left: 25px; font-size: 18px; font-weight: 200; line-height: 40px; border-bottom: 1px dotted #c3c3c3;}
.goodsdt .list .ttd a, a:active, a:visited {color: #000;}
.goodsdt .list .ttd a:hover {color: #fc2828;}
.goodsdt .contain {width: 940px; position: relative; float: left; border-left: 1px dotted #c3c3c3; padding-left: 15px; min-height: 450px;}
.goodsdt .contain .intro {width: 925px; height: auto; margin-bottom: 15px;}
.goodsdt .contain .intro .conta {width: 925px; height: auto; padding: 0px 10px 15px 0px; position: relative; float: left; font-size: 22px; line-height: 36px; text-align: justify;}
.goodsdt .contain .intro .conta .coutbox {width: 98%; height: auto; padding: 15px; position: relative; line-height: 24px; font-size: 18px; border-radius: 5px; background: #ffc; border: 1px dotted #fc2828; margin:10px auto; box-shadow: 0 0 3px 0px rgba(0,0,0, 0.3); text-align: justify;}
.goodsdt .contain .intro .conta .title_lm {
    background-color: #fc2828; width: 100%; padding: 5px; color: #fff;
}
.goodsdt .contain .intro .conta .qrcode {width:400px; height:450px; margin:10px 20px; float: left; text-align:center;}
.goodsdt .contain .intro .conta a, a:visited, a:hover {color: #fc2828;}
.goodsdt .contain .s1 {font-size: 18px; font-weight: 300;}



#DoorP {border:0px; width:98%; padding:4px; background:#fff;}
.TDDEALTITLE {font-size: 20px; font-weight:bold;}
.content {
	overflow:hidden;
	color:#000;
	padding-left:10px;
	padding-top:3px;
	line-height:24px;
	font-size:18px;
}
.title01 {width:100%; height:40px; background-image: linear-gradient(to right, #fc2828, #fc2828, #fca5a5, #fcd1d1); color: #fff; cursor:pointer; padding-left: 5px; margin: 2px auto;}
.title02 {width:100%; height:auto; background: #F5F5F5; color: #000; cursor:pointer; border: 1px dotted #fc2828; padding: 5px; margin: 5px auto; display: none; text-align: justify;}

#qlist {
	width: 930px; height: 615px;
}
.ttline {background: #fc2828; color: #FFF; padding-left: 5px;}
.txidt {text-indent: 2em;}







